ProgrammableFilter.cxx
#include <vtkSmartPointer.h> #include <vtkSphereSource.h> #include <vtkProgrammableFilter.h> #include <vtkPolyDataMapper.h> #include <vtkActor.h> #include <vtkRenderWindow.h> #include <vtkRenderer.h> #include <vtkRenderWindowInteractor.h> struct params { vtkPolyData* data; vtkProgrammableFilter* filter; }; void AdjustPoints(void* arguments) { params* input = static_cast<params*>(arguments); vtkPoints* inPts = input->data->GetPoints(); vtkIdType numPts = inPts->GetNumberOfPoints(); vtkSmartPointer<vtkPoints> newPts = vtkSmartPointer<vtkPoints>::New(); newPts->SetNumberOfPoints(numPts); for(vtkIdType i = 0; i < numPts/2; i++) { double p[3]; inPts->GetPoint(i, p); p[0] = p[0] + 1.0; p[1] = p[1] + 1.0; p[2] = p[2] + 1.0; newPts->SetPoint(i, p); } input->filter->GetPolyDataOutput()->CopyStructure(input->data); input->filter->GetPolyDataOutput()->SetPoints(newPts); } int main(int, char *[]) { //Create a sphere vtkSmartPointer<vtkSphereSource> sphereSource = vtkSmartPointer<vtkSphereSource>::New(); sphereSource->Update(); vtkSmartPointer<vtkProgrammableFilter> programmableFilter = vtkSmartPointer<vtkProgrammableFilter>::New(); programmableFilter->SetInputConnection(sphereSource->GetOutputPort()); params myParams; myParams.data = sphereSource->GetOutput(); myParams.filter = programmableFilter; programmableFilter->SetExecuteMethod(AdjustPoints, &myParams); programmableFilter->Update(); //Create a mapper and actor vtkSmartPointer<vtkPolyDataMapper> mapper = vtkSmartPointer<vtkPolyDataMapper>::New(); mapper->SetInputConnection(programmableFilter->GetOutputPort()); vtkSmartPointer<vtkActor> actor = vtkSmartPointer<vtkActor>::New(); actor->SetMapper(mapper); //Create a renderer, render window, and interactor vtkSmartPointer<vtkRenderer> renderer = vtkSmartPointer<vtkRenderer>::New(); vtkSmartPointer<vtkRenderWindow> renderWindow = vtkSmartPointer<vtkRenderWindow>::New(); renderWindow->AddRenderer(renderer); vtkSmartPointer<vtkRenderWindowInteractor> renderWindowInteractor = vtkSmartPointer<vtkRenderWindowInteractor>::New(); renderWindowInteractor->SetRenderWindow(renderWindow); //Add the actor to the scene renderer->AddActor(actor); renderer->SetBackground(1,1,1); // Background color white //Render and interact renderWindow->Render(); renderWindowInteractor->Start(); return EXIT_SUCCESS; }
CMakeLists.txt
cmake_minimum_required(VERSION 2.8) PROJECT(ProgrammableFilter) find_package(VTK REQUIRED) include(${VTK_USE_FILE}) if (APPLE) add_executable(ProgrammableFilter MACOSX_BUNDLE ProgrammableFilter.cxx) else() add_executable(ProgrammableFilter ProgrammableFilter.cxx) endif() if(VTK_LIBRARIES) target_link_libraries(ProgrammableFilter ${VTK_LIBRARIES}) else() target_link_libraries(ProgrammableFilter vtkHybrid ) endif()
